Event of the Day: Chennai Super Kings versus Delhi Capitals

Our event of the day is the IPL playoff match between the Chennai Super Kings and the Delhi Capitals at the Dr. Y. S. Rajasekhara Reddy ACA–VDCA Cricket Stadium in Visakhapatnam. The Chennai Super Kings, the IPL defending champions, have one last attempt to make the final after losing to the Mumbai Indians earlier in the week. They face the Delhi Capitals, who hope to make their first IPL final. This is sure to be an exciting match of T20 cricket. The Chennai Super Kings will do everything not to let the season end without a chance to defend their 2018 title. However, that defence hit an obstacle when they lost their qualifier match to the Mumbai Indians on Tuesday. The Super Kings were stymied by their opening three batters only managing twenty-two runs in 5.5 overs. While Murali Vijay, Ambati Rayudu and MS Dhoni managed 105 runs, the damage had been done and Chennai finished their twenty overs with Mumbai chasing just 131. A seventy-one run performance from Suryakumar Yadav was a major fact in Mumbai’s route to the final. However, the Super Kings will have their chance for revenge if they can win today, as that would set up a rematch against the Indians. To do that, they will have to overcome the Delhi Capitals.

The Capitals, who finished third in the regular season standings, began the playoffs well with a win over the Sunrisers Hyderabad. Despite a strong 162-run inning by Hyderabad, a half-century from Prithvi Shaw and forty-nine runs from Rishabh Pant helped put the Capitals into the second qualifier. When Delhi and Chennai met in the regular season, Chennai won both matches. The first, in late March, saw a six-wicket win for the Super Kings. The second, a little over a week ago, was a dominant rout by Chennai. After Delhi elected to field after winning the toss, Chennai scored 179 before holding Delhi to just ninety-nine in their twenty overs. Delhi has never made a finals appearance before while Chennai hunt their fourth title and seventh finals appearance. The Capitals come into the match with some potent assets at their disposal - the league’s fourth-highest run score in Shikhar Dhawan and the league’s top wicket-taker in Kagiso Rabada. Meanwhile, the Super Kings will look to their star players like Dhoni, Faf Du Plessis and Suresh Rania, to take them to the final. Be sure you don’t miss this exciting match.

Honourable mentions around the globe go to the NBA, where the Houston Rockets host the Golden State Warriors at the Toyota Center for game six of their conference semi-final series. The Warriors can clinch the series with a win tonight. However, they will likely be without Kevin Durant, who left game five with a calf injury. This potentially presents a perfect opportunity for James Harden and the Rockets to tie the series and force a game seven. You will not want to miss the next instalment of one of the NBA’s most exciting series.
